McDonald’s employees Alexis Capers and Tariq Baines were rewarded with $1,000 scholarship for their generosity.
Since 2014, McDonald’s Owner/Operators Tanya and Wayne Holliday helped support an annual scholarship on behalf of the late Deacon Juan Gaskins of Philadelphia.
The Juan Gaskins Generosity Scholarship supports two college bound students who exemplify generosity and kindness, are members of the Bethlehem Baptist Church; and are honor roll students at their high school.
This year, Tariq Baine and Alexis Capers, both of North Penn High School, were recipients of the scholarship. Tariq plans to attend Penn State University in the fall and study marketing, while Alexis plans to attend Lafayette College and study policy studies.
Both students boasted a 3.0 GPA and have made numerous contributions within the local community.
